Transaction 5289751dc4ad08e6043bf63b952cc8d3a2a7c1caa64f5beb7649deab62607c8e

1 Input
2 Outputs
  • 5289751dc4ad08e6043bf63b952cc8d3a2a7c1caa64f5beb7649deab62607c8e:0
  • value  11982385
    address  37kjELzLbnZneE7UA23BJcfj6hjewersXk
  • 5289751dc4ad08e6043bf63b952cc8d3a2a7c1caa64f5beb7649deab62607c8e:1
  • value  1876780
    address  18H2Act3KUk16HPvEAHZnu56RoZQjvUbiK